DC fans have been waiting eagerly for the release of Shazam! Fury Of The Gods, which is hitting cinemas this month. Directed by David F. Sandberg, the film features Billy Batson (Asher Angel) and his foster siblings transforming into superheroes once again to take on a new threat in the Daughters of Atlas. Zachary Levi returns as Shazam, and the cast also includes Adam Brody, Rachel Zegler, Ross Butler, Meagan Good, Lucy Liu, Djimon Hounsou, and Helen Mirren.

If you plan on watching the film, make sure to stay until the end. Shazam! Fury Of The Gods features two scenes during the end credits: one after the mid-credits and another after the rest have rolled. DC has other films coming up in 2023, including The Flash (June 16), Blue Beetle (August 18), and Aquaman And The Lost Kingdom (December 25). Additionally, James Gunn has confirmed he will be directing a new Superman film, titled Superman Legacy, for the studio, scheduled to be released in July 2025.

Despite the hype surrounding the film, NME gave Shazam! Fury Of The Gods a two-star rating. The review states, “Fury Of The Gods gets a big silly ending which is occasionally fun, but there’s a cheap and clumsy feel to everything — a superhero sequel made in the same vague shape as a dozen others.”
